Cain's Ballroom in Tulsa isn’t just a concert hall, it’s a legendary spot where music history and raw energy collide. This place has seen it all from soulful country legends like Willie Nelson to gritty rock acts, and it still pulls in big names for concerts that leave people talking for days. When you walk in, the vibe hits you, rustic charm mixed with a kind of gritty authenticity that makes every show feel special. The venue’s bar serves up local beers and creative drinks that hit the spot after a long day or during the perfect opening act. It’s also pretty cool how they honor Tulsa’s rich culture by inviting indigenous performers and showcasing local artisans, giving the whole experience a real community feel. Accessibility is taken seriously here too, with well-thought-out seating so everyone can enjoy the show, and some seats even let you peek behind the curtain and see musicians interact off-stage.
